Andy Ender, age group 1976 of Swiss nationality. He lives and works as a freelance artist in the Alsace in France. Inventor of the water pipe with lid "Swiss Ice Bong". His water pipe with lid is a patented invention. Pioneer of the Fusionism and Neo-cloisonnism. The themes of his works are closely intertwined with the sociology, reclusion, accumulation, ethnology, urbanization, with the symbols and social problems, which as a contemporary video art, painting, photography, sculpture and print are depicted. Coincident are his works avant-garde, such as those "Contemporary Collages" or "Fusionism". His works are inspired of the public sphere and the empiricism. The artist has in Switzerland, France and also in Netherlands exhibitions opened. He has considerable works in private collections.
